I bring you Commander Lenore:

fluff:
Lenore is armed with a plasma pistol and power fist. Lenore is a veteran, having served over two centuries. His trademark is his left side, famously blown off by his trusty plasma pistol in his first battle as a sergeant. His commander, Learchus, was torn limb from limb by a daemon prince. His boltgun spent, Lenore dived under the daemon's swipe and whipped up the still-burning plasma pistol. Though it's cells had not had time to cool, he had no choice. He fired, and the shot sent the howling daemon back to the warp. The sergeant's entire left side was left a smouldering wreck, but luckily apothecary Dacus was nearby. following immediate thunderhawk extraction, the unconscious marine saved the planet of Garntis. For his actions, Lenore was promoted to be the new commander of Muninn. The plasma pistol was crafted in the days before the heresy, and is made of sterner stuff than its more modern counterparts- it survived the overheating and Lenore still uses it.

points: 200.
WS6 BS5 S4 T4(5) A3 W3 I5 Ld10 Sv2+

Wargear:
master-crafted power fist
artificier armour
iron halo
extensive bionics- as much machine as he is man, Lenore gains +1T, as if he is on a bike (so he can still be ID'ed by S8 stuff)
plasma pistol- If it overheats, he ignores it, because all his parts that would be damaged by it have already been replaced.

special rules:
feel no pain
eternal warrior
ATSKNF
combat tactics- a sergeant in the army may be selected to be "Venerable", meaning he has FNP.
hard as nails- Lenore is so tough, on the turn he dies, on a 3+, he gets back up with 1 wound remaining. This may only happen once.
legendary resilience- due to his legend, all friendly units within 18" of him may use his Ld.

would he stand up to lysander? no. yet they are the same points. SC's tend to be thier equivalent (captain) with thier wargear, and each USR/SR is about 10 points, depending on how good they are.
captain- 100 (100)
PF- 25 (125)
plasma pistol- 15 (140)
artificier armour- 15 (155)
FNP- 15 (170)
extensive bionics- 10 (180)
hard as nails- 15 (195)
legendary resilience- 10 (205)
ET- 10 (215)
then they shave off a few points to round it off (200).
